  • Logistics Management Specialist

    Strategic Systems Programs Office (Washington Navy Yard, DC)

Responsibilities You will support the acquisition and life-cycle support of the Trident II (D5) Strategic Weapons Systems (SWS) and U.K. Submarines. You will be involved in the Submarine build with logistics planning, policy instruction updates, adjudication of findings from audits and evaluations, and performance of required reviews. You will formulate and implement policy related to acquisition of U.K. supply system stock and allowances, inventory management, pricing criteria and issue authority for U.S. supply system material. You will formulate and implement policy related to requisition processing, allowance documentation, repair support, budgeting and disposal. You will conduct review of procedures established to implement policy to ensure adequate support is provided to the U.K. and to identify problem areas and associated corrective actions. You will determine the resource requirements for government and contractor technical services, procurement of supply system material and test equipment, and transportation. You will participate in Logistics Exchanges (LOGEX) attended by senior logistics personnel, which are comprehensive program reviews designed to review current status and to assist in future planning. You will direct physical inventory and validation of equipment in U.K. operating spaces against the associated maintenance and allowance documentation. You will plan, budget and monitor expenditures for the outfitting, replenishment, and replacement of U.K. Test Measurement and Diagnostic Equipment (TMDE) as approved by SSP. Provides logistics support for TMDE as identified in SSP Policy documents. Requirements Conditions of Employment Qualifications Your resume must also demonstrate at least one year of specialized experience at or equivalent to the GS-11 grade level or NH-02 pay band in the Federal service or equivalent experience in the private or public sector. Specialized experience must demonstrate the following: supporting the acquisition and life-cycle support of a major weapons system and the ability to interpret import/export laws and regulations as well as basic knowledge of budgeting, transportation, procurement, allowance documents and inventory management concepts.
